Introduction to Javanese Language and Its Cultural Significance
The Javanese language is a member of the Austronesian language family, primarily spoken by the Javanese people, who reside mostly in Central and East Java, Indonesia. With over 80 million speakers, it is one of the most widely spoken languages in Indonesia. The history of Javanese language can be traced back to the 9th century, with early inscriptions found on ancient stone tablets written in the language. Over time, Javanese developed through the influence of Indian culture and later Islamic and European colonization. The language has a rich literary tradition, particularly in its classical poetry, epic tales, and royal court music.
Sub-tags and Classifications of Javanese Language Music
Gamelan
Gamelan is a traditional ensemble of Javanese music, often featuring a variety of percussion instruments like metallophones, gongs, and drums. This genre is one of the core elements of Javanese music and is integral to the cultural heritage of Java. Gamelan music has been used in royal courts, religious rituals, and cultural ceremonies.

Wayang Kulit
Wayang Kulit, the shadow puppet theatre of Java, is accompanied by a form of music that blends dramatic narration with Gamelan music. The music plays a crucial role in setting the tone and enhancing the performance of these cultural and spiritual performances.
Dangdut Jawa
Dangdut Jawa is a modern form of Javanese music that blends traditional gamelan rhythms with the popular genre of dangdut, which has roots in Indian and Malay influences. It has become a popular genre in the modern Javanese music scene, often featuring vibrant and danceable rhythms.
